Which of the following nursing actions is most directly aimed at affording a client confidential treatment of his or her medical information while minimizing delay in accessing needed medical and nursing care?

Correct Answer: A

Rationale: Under new regulations,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act(HIPAA), in order to eliminate barriers that could delay access to care, required only that health care providers notify clients of their privacy policy and make a reasonable effort to get written acknowledgment of this notification.
